DT Jerrell Powe returns; DT Kyle Love released

DT Jerrell Powe returns; DT Kyle Love released

Herbie Teope December 3, 2013

KANSAS CITY, Mo. – The Chiefs on Tuesday signed defensive tackle Jerrell Powe, according to the NFL Transactions report.

To make room on the roster for Powe, the Chiefs cut ties with defensive tackle Kyle Love, who signed on Nov. 19.

The Chiefs originally selected Powe in the sixth round of the 2011 NFL Draft out of Mississippi. The 6-foot-2, 335-pound defensive tackle totaled five tackles and an assist in 2012.

The team released Powe during the final rounds of cuts before the start of the 2013 regular season.

Meanwhile, the Chiefs also brought back rookie fullback Toben Opurum, signing him to the practice squad.

Kansas City previously released Opurum from the practice squad in Week 12.
